
Einkorn, an ancient grain revered for its nutritional benefits, has sparked interest among health enthusiasts, particularly those following a ketogenic diet. The keto diet, characterized by its high-fat, low-carbohydrate approach, aims to induce a metabolic state known as ketosis, where the body burns fat for fuel instead of carbohydrates. Einkorn, with its lower glycemic index compared to modern wheat, is often considered a healthier alternative. However, determining whether einkorn is keto-friendly requires a closer examination of its macronutrient profile and its impact on blood sugar levels.

Einkorn, an ancient grain, has been gaining popularity among health-conscious individuals due to its lower glycemic index (GI) compared to regular wheat. The glycemic index is a measure of how quickly foods raise blood sugar levels. Foods with a high GI cause a rapid spike in blood sugar, while foods with a low GI result in a slower, more gradual increase. This makes einkorn a potentially better choice for those following a ketogenic diet, as it may help maintain a state of ketosis by preventing large fluctuations in blood sugar levels.
One of the key benefits of einkorn's lower GI is its potential to improve insulin sensitivity. When blood sugar levels rise slowly, the body has more time to respond with insulin, the hormone responsible for regulating blood sugar. This can lead to better glucose control and reduced risk of developing insulin resistance, a condition often associated with type 2 diabetes. For individuals on a keto diet, maintaining insulin sensitivity is crucial, as it helps the body efficiently utilize fat for energy.

Einkorn is an ancient type of wheat that is considered one of the earliest domesticated forms of wheat. It has a higher protein content and more nutrients compared to modern wheat varieties.
Einkorn is not typically considered keto-friendly because it is still a form of wheat and contains carbohydrates. The ketogenic diet is low in carbohydrates and high in fats, so most grains, including Einkorn, are limited or avoided on this diet.
While Einkorn is not typically included in a strict ketogenic diet, it may be possible to include it in a low-carb diet in moderation. Einkorn has a lower glycemic index compared to modern wheat, which means it may have a slower impact on blood sugar levels. However, it is important to monitor portion sizes and ensure that it fits within your daily carbohydrate goals.
